About Subramaniam D. N.

Subramaniam D. N., With an exceptional h-index of 8 and a recent h-index of 7 (since 2020), a distinguished researcher at University of Jaffna, specializes in the field of Water treatment, stormwater management, pervious concrete, contaminant transport, construction and demolition waste.
